Middleweight contender Paulo Costa has voiced his intense displeasure after not being awarded a post-fight bonus following UFC 327. Costa specifically directed his ire towards fellow fighter Josh Hokit, labeling him a “bum” and suggesting Hokit’s own performance warranted no bonus.
The Brazilian fighter, known for his powerful striking and sometimes controversial outspokenness, took to social media to vent his frustration. He implied that Hokit’s less-than-impressive showing was the reason why the coveted performance bonuses, typically given to the most exciting fights or individual displays, were distributed elsewhere. Costa believes his own effort deserved recognition and that Hokit’s presence in contention for a bonus was unwarranted.
It remains unclear if there was any direct interaction or specific reason for Costa to call out Hokit, beyond the shared context of the UFC 327 event and the bonus distribution.
